Solution 1:
While products is indeed of type IPagedList<Product_List>, the call to .Where() on an instance of IPagedList<Product_List> returns an IEnumerable<Product_List>, which can't be implicitly converted. Notice how you perform conversions here:
products = _db.Product_list.OrderByDescending(m => m.ID)
.ToPagedList(pageIndex, pageSize);
You just need to perform the same conversion after your .Where() call:
products = products.Where(m => m.ID.ToUpper().Contains(searchString.ToUpper()) ||
m.Product_name.ToUpper().Contains(searchString.ToUpper()))
.ToPagedList(pageIndex, pageSize);
